Like many Americans, I’ve always been conflicted when buying products made in China because of the CCP (Chinese Communist Party). The sad reality is that most red dot optics are made in China. I was surprised to learn that Primary Arms was producing a US-made micro-reflex sight.

I was excited to see it firsthand. It promises to be a very advanced design with one of the lowest bases of any MRD. This one is low enough to use factory iron sights on a MOS cut Glock slide. It is also one of the more expensive MRDs on the market at $650. It will be available on the Primary Arms website later in April
